| Description: | RAPMIDE Tablet contains Loperamide Hydrochloride 2 mg, an effective antidiarrheal medicine indicated for the symptomatic management of acute and chronic diarrhea. It acts by reducing intestinal motility, thereby increasing the absorption of fluids and electrolytes from the intestine. This helps control diarrhea, reduce stool frequency, and improve stool consistency. RAPMIDE Tablet should be used under the guidance of a healthcare professional and is intended for symptomatic relief rather than treatment of the underlying cause of diarrhea. |

| Precaution: | Use only under medical supervision. Do not use in patients with bloody diarrhea, high fever, or suspected bacterial enterocolitis without medical advice. Stop using the medicine and consult your doctor if symptoms persist beyond 48 hours or worsen. Avoid use in children unless prescribed by a healthcare professional. RAPMIDE Tablet is used for the symptomatic treatment of acute and chronic diarrhea. It helps reduce the frequency of loose stools and improves stool consistency.
It contains Loperamide Hydrochloride 2 mg, an antidiarrheal medication.
Loperamide slows the movement of the intestines, allowing more water and electrolytes to be absorbed from the bowel. This results in firmer stools and fewer bowel movements.
